My 2009 Ultra High Relief St Gaudens Double Eagle arrived today. I was NOT happy to find it sitting on my front porch this afternoon because I had requested that it be delivered to my PO box. At least it was not stolen. Anyway, I snapped a couple of photos of the coin. I could not get it out of the capsule so that limited what I could do photographing it. It is a stunning coin. The relief is GREAT!. The obverse is deeply dished. Not sure if that shows in the photo. I was able to compare this coin to a genuine MCMVII Ultra High Relief on display at the ANA's Bass Museum. While the 2009 is a good reproduction of the origina designl it is not completely faithful. But I can (barely) afford the 2009 UHR whereas I could never think of owning an MCMVII UHR.
